What Tdcs offers today
In recent years, researchers and clinicians have explored transcranial direct current stimulation as a tool to modulate brain activity with relatively simple equipment. The technique uses a low-intensity electrical current delivered through scalp electrodes to influence neural circuits. Practitioners emphasise careful application, proper dosing, and clear objectives to avoid inconsistent Tdcs results. For individuals curious about practical outcomes, Tdcs is typically discussed in terms of potential cognitive and mood benefits, with attention to safety guidelines and realistic expectations. Clarifying personal goals helps determine if this modality aligns with broader well being strategies.
Considerations for safe use
Safety remains the primary focus for anyone considering Tdcs as part of a routine. Proper electrode placement, controlled current strength, and adherence to time limits are essential to reducing risk. Users should seek guidance from qualified professionals, particularly when addressing medical conditions Portable Brain Stimulation Device or concurrent medications. In non clinical settings, following manufacturer instructions and avoiding continuous or excessive sessions can help maintain a responsible approach. Individuals with implanted devices or neurological disorders may require professional evaluation before use.

What scientific evidence suggests
Current research presents a nuanced picture of how tdCs might influence attention, memory, and mood. While several studies report positive effects in certain tasks or populations, results are often modest and context dependent. Critics caution against overgeneralising findings, urging people to view Tdcs as a potential aid rather than a standalone solution. Ongoing trials and meta-analyses aim to clarify best practices and safety profiles for diverse groups.
